I was wondering if anyone could help me out with specs for a medium sized
spray booth? My work tends to be no more than 18-24" tall. Of course,
that could change. I would like it to be compact to some degree since my
studio is about 300 square feet.

Thanks for your help!

Peter (www.petercunicelli.com)

Tim Steele on mon 2 may 05


Peter:

The Jan/Feb 2003 issue of "Clay Times" has an article by Vince Pitelka with
plans for a collapsable spray booth that would probably suit your needs. I
built one and it works great.
